attributeerror 3a this querydict instance is immutable django

Solutions on MaxInterview for attributeerror 3a this querydict instance is immutable django by the best coders in the world

showing results for - "attributeerror 3a this querydict instance is immutable django"
Luca
12 Aug 2017
1#views.py
2from rest_framework import generics
3
4
5class Login(generics.CreateAPIView):
6    serializer_class = MySerializerClass
7    def create(self, request, *args, **kwargs):
8        request.data._mutable = True
9        request.data['username'] = "example@mail.com"
10        request.data._mutable = False
11
12#serializes.py
13from rest_framework import serializers
14
15
16class MySerializerClass(serializers.Serializer):
17    username = serializers.CharField(required=False)
18    password = serializers.CharField(required=False)
19    class Meta:
20        fields = ('username', 'password')
21